Meta AI users may be inadvertently making their searches public without realising it.

Mozilla Petition> Meta: Help Users Stop Accidentally Sharing Private AI Conversations
Meta recently launched its own AI app, like ChatGPT. The Meta AI app comes with a “Discover Feed” — a public stream of real user AI conversations posted by users. Meta says that users know that they're sharing their AI conversations publicly. But a number of posts suggest otherwise. You can find posts that appear to show users' personal data, medical issues, work problems, and calendar reminders in the Discover Feed.
